Description Nizhnevolskoe (Aromatic)
Summer variety, developed at the Volgograd Experimental Station of the All-Union Institute of Plant Breeding named after N. I. Vavilov. Breeders: V. V. Malychenko and L. I. Balandina. Originated from the sowing of seeds of free-pollinated flowers of Lithuanian Pippin. Underwent state variety trials in the Volgograd and Astrakhan regions.

Trees on strong-growing rootstocks are large, with wide crowns and slightly drooping lower branches. Crown density is high.

Shoots are curved, brown, hairy, with few, round-sectioned, small stipules. Leaves are smaller than average, narrow with a broad-acute base and apex, smoothly transitioning into a small tip. Leaf blade is significantly curved, slightly folded, slightly concave in the upper half, weakly twisted. Its edge is wavy, usually double-toothed. Bracteoles are small, lanceolate.

Fruits are medium-sized, one-dimensional, moderately flattened, round, without clearly distinguishable ribs. Main color at harvest is yellow-green, with uneven, soft blush covering more than half of the fruit surface, with pink and red streaks (interrupted stripes). Few lenticels, but large, light-colored, easily noticeable. Skin is thin, smooth with slight waxy coating. Blemish is of medium depth, narrow, smooth or with slight roughness of skin. Pedicel is medium length and thickness, protruding from the blemish. Calyx is medium-sized, half-open. Receptacle is small, narrow, wrinkled. Subcalyx tube is conical or cylindrical, medium width and depth. Seed chambers are closed. Central cavity is narrow, not communicating with seed chambers.
Flesh is snowy-white, fine-grained, tender, juicy, with excellent sour-sweet taste and strong aroma. Exceptionally attractive aroma, due to which the variety is highly popular among the population. Chemical composition of fruits: dry matter — 17.1% (max 17.7%), sugar sum — 10.8% (11.9%), titratable acids — 0.65% (1.0%) on fresh weight, sugar-to-acid ratio — 18.6 (25.3), ascorbic acid — 8.2 (8.7) mg/100g, P-active substances (catechins) — 46 mg/100g, flavonols — 37 mg/100g, total phenolic compounds — 730 mg/100g, pectic substances — 0.79% on fresh weight.
Summer ripening variety. Harvest ripeness occurs at the beginning of August.
Fruits are stored for one month.

Trees enter fruiting early — at 3-5 years. Yield is very high, annual. Winter hardiness is at the level of Red Anise and higher than Lithuanian Pippin.
Trees require protection against scab, resistance to powdery mildew is average.

Advantages of the variety: fruits have high commercial and consumer qualities, best fruits for producing highly aromatic juice.

Disadvantages of the variety: tall trees, relatively weak resistance to scab in wet years, which occur rarely in the lower reaches of the Volga.
